NHL Hockey '96 on Game Boy is one of those old-school sports games that somehow makes tiny pixels feel like a full-blown hockey match. You pick your team—I always went for the Red Wings back then—and jump right into a surprisingly fast game of 5-on-5. The controls are simple (A to pass, B to shoot), but timing your slapshots just right takes practice.

The players are these little blobs with helmets, yet you can totally tell the difference between a winger and a goalie by how they move. The crowd noise is just a basic loop of cheering, but when you finally break through the defense and score, it still feels awesome. And yeah, fights happen—just mash buttons until someone ends up in the penalty box.

It’s not the prettiest hockey game now, but for a Game Boy title, it nails the speed and chaos of real hockey. Just don’t expect fancy dekes or realistic physics.
